For our client, a leading logistics and transportation company in the United Kingdom, we are looking for experienced and reliable HGV Drivers to join their growing transport operations team.

Salary Range: £35,000 – £50,000 per annum + Overtime & Night Allowance (depending on experience and licence category)

Location: United Kingdom | On-site (regional and national delivery routes)

  • Operate HGV Class 1 (C+E) or Class 2 (C) vehicles safely and efficiently
  • Transport goods to warehouses, distribution centres, and customer locations
  • Carry out pre-trip and post-trip vehicle inspections and report any defects
  • Ensure loads are correctly secured and comply with transport safety regulations
  • Adhere to UK driving laws, Driver Hours regulations, and Working Time Directive
  • Provide professional service when interacting with clients and delivery sites

Requirements:

  • Valid UK HGV Class 1 (C+E) or Class 2 (C) driving license
  • Valid Digital Tachograph Card
  • Previous HGV driving experience preferred
  • Good knowledge of UK road networks and logistics operations
  • Ability to work flexible shifts, including nights or weekends if required

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ary with overtime and shift allowances
  • Performance bonuses and safe driving incentives
  • Company pension scheme
  • Paid holidays according to UK employment law
  • Modern, well-maintained fleet of vehicles
  • Ongoing CPC training and development support
  • Long-term career stability with a growing logistics company
